Output 299fd62666f3063c12e5a08b4277bbabc962d80590673f0e7518d0ed3b69c34f:1

value
24056507
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7dcb679ef1bd7647d101ef1d2997bf2c8a434649 OP_EQUALVERIFY OP_CHECKSIG
address
1CU98npJ1Qpkmv3toQVqVVX4dJaxnYjA4C
transaction
299fd62666f3063c12e5a08b4277bbabc962d80590673f0e7518d0ed3b69c34f
confirmations
283047
spent
true